Army rugby team receive $5000 from Subrails for FMF Sukuna Bowl

By Shanil Singh
07/12/2020
Memebers of the The Subrails Army team.

The Army rugby team will be known as Subrails Army in the FMF Sukuna Bowl after receiving $5000 from Subrails today.

Subrails Managing Director Shiva Gounder says this is a milestone as it will also enable them to do their part in helping the needy children of the country since this year’s Sukuna Bowl is a charity event.

Army Rugby Chairman Aseri Rokoura has thanked Subrails for the sponsorship despite most businesses in Fiji facing the effects of COVID-19.

army-2

A number of household names such as Fiji 7s captain Meli Derenalagi, Manasa Saulo, Jone Manu, John Stewart and Isireli Ledua are expected to feature for Army.

Army won the Sukuna Bowl last year after beating Police 20-17 at the ANZ Stadium.

The Sukuna Bowl will be played at 4.30pm Friday and you can catch the live commentary on Viti FM.
